掌握MySQL账号密码,安全登录指南
mysql的账号密码

首页 2025-07-26 23:26:33



MySQL账号密码:安全性的基石 在数字时代,数据安全性无疑是企业和个人都必须高度重视的问题

    MySQL,作为世界上最流行的开源关系型数据库管理系统之一,其账号密码的安全性更是关乎整个数据库乃至整个信息系统的安全

    因此,我们必须深入理解MySQL账号密码的重要性,并学会如何妥善管理和保护这些信息

     一、MySQL账号密码的重要性 MySQL数据库的账号密码是访问数据库的关键,它控制着谁能够访问数据库,以及能够进行哪些操作

    一个弱密码或者泄露的密码,可能导致未授权的用户轻松访问数据库,进而窃取、篡改或删除重要数据

    在数据驱动的商业环境中,这样的安全风险是任何组织都无法承受的

     此外,账号密码的安全性也直接关系到数据库的完整性和业务的连续性

    一旦非法用户获得了数据库的访问权限,他们可能会进行恶意操作,如注入恶意代码、删除关键数据或进行勒索软件攻击

    这些行为不仅会导致数据丢失或损坏,还可能对企业的声誉和财务造成巨大损失

     二、如何设置安全的MySQL账号密码 1.使用强密码:强密码是防止暴力破解的第一道防线

    一个安全的密码应该包含大小写字母、数字和特殊字符的组合,并且长度要足够长

    避免使用容易猜测或与个人信息紧密相关的密码

     2.定期更换密码:定期更新密码可以减少密码被猜测或破解的风险

    建议每隔一段时间就更换一次密码,并确保新密码与旧密码有明显的差异

     3.不要共享账号:每个用户都应该有自己独立的账号和密码

    共享账号会增加安全风险,因为无法追踪到具体的操作行为

     4.启用双重认证:为了进一步提高安全性,可以启用双重认证机制

    这意味着除了密码之外,还需要提供额外的验证信息,如手机验证码或生物识别信息

     三、如何保护MySQL账号密码 1.加密存储:MySQL账号密码应该以加密的形式存储在服务器上,以防止未经授权的访问

    使用哈希函数对密码进行加密是一种常见的做法,这样即使数据库被非法访问,攻击者也无法直接获取到明文密码

     2.限制访问权限:根据用户的角色和职责,为其分配适当的数据库访问权限

    不要给予用户过多的权限,以减少潜在的安全风险

     3.监控和日志记录:启用数据库的监控和日志记录功能,以便跟踪和审计所有对数据库的访问和操作

    这有助于及时发现任何可疑行为,并采取相应的安全措施

     4.定期安全审查:定期对数据库进行安全审查,确保没有潜在的漏洞或配置错误

    这包括检查用户账号的权限设置、密码策略的执行情况等

     四、应对账号密码泄露的风险 尽管我们采取了各种预防措施,但仍然存在账号密码泄露的风险

    一旦怀疑或确认账号密码已经泄露,应立即采取以下措施: 1.立即更改密码:如果发现账号密码可能已被泄露,应立即更改密码,并确保新密码的复杂性和安全性

     2.审查并限制访问:审查所有用户的访问权限,确保没有未经授权的访问

    同时,限制或撤销可能已被泄露账号的访问权限,以防止进一步的损害

     3.安全审计:进行全面的安全审计,查找并修复可能的安全漏洞

    这包括检查服务器的安全配置、更新和补丁情况,以及数据库的访问控制等

     4.通知相关方:如果账号密码泄露可能影响到客户或合作伙伴的数据安全,应及时通知他们,并提供必要的支持和建议

     五、总结 MySQL的账号密码是保护数据库安全的第一道防线

    我们必须高度重视账号密码的安全性,通过设置强密码、定期更换密码、不共享账号以及启用双重认证等措施来加强保护

    同时,加密存储、限制访问权限、监控和日志记录以及定期安全审查也是必不可少的环节

    在账号密码泄露的情况下,我们应立即采取行动,更改密码、审查访问权限、进行安全审计并通知相关方

    只有这样,我们才能确保数据库的安全性,保护企业的核心资产不受损害

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道